How Do Air Purification Systems Improve Indoor Air?
Air purification systems capture airborne particles, neutralize odors, and eliminate bacteria and viruses that circulate through your HVAC system.
High-efficiency filters trap dust, pollen, pet dander, and mold spores before they enter your living areas. This reduces allergy symptoms and respiratory irritation for occupants.
UV light systems installed in ductwork kill bacteria, viruses, and mold on contact. These systems work continuously to sterilize air passing through your HVAC equipment.
Activated carbon filters absorb volatile organic compounds and odors from cleaning products, cooking, and building materials. Combining multiple filtration technologies provides comprehensive air cleaning.
Which Indoor Air Quality Problems Are Most Common?
Common issues include excessive dust, mold growth, high humidity, low humidity, stale air, and lingering odors that affect comfort and health.
Excessive dust accumulation on surfaces indicates inadequate filtration or duct leaks. Improving filtration and sealing ducts reduces dust circulation.
Mold growth appears in damp areas when humidity exceeds 60%. Dehumidifiers and proper ventilation control moisture levels and prevent mold proliferation.
Dry air during winter causes static electricity, dry skin, and respiratory discomfort. Whole-home humidifiers add moisture to maintain comfortable humidity levels between 30% and 50%.
Stale air results from insufficient ventilation. Energy recovery ventilators exchange indoor air with fresh outdoor air while preserving heating or cooling energy.

Can Humidity Control Affect Both Comfort and Health?
Yes, maintaining proper humidity levels improves comfort, protects property, and reduces respiratory issues and allergy symptoms.
High humidity makes indoor spaces feel warmer than the actual temperature and promotes mold growth. Dehumidifiers extract excess moisture, making cooling more effective and preventing mold.
Low humidity dries out mucous membranes, increasing susceptibility to respiratory infections and worsening asthma symptoms. Humidifiers add moisture to alleviate these problems.
Balanced humidity also protects wood furniture, flooring, and musical instruments from warping or cracking. This preservation extends the life of your property's interior elements.
Whole-home humidity control integrates with your HVAC system for automatic operation. These systems maintain ideal levels year-round without manual adjustment.
How Does Pflugerville's Suburban Setting Influence Air Quality Needs?
Pflugerville's mix of residential neighborhoods, green spaces, and nearby agricultural areas introduces pollen, dust, and outdoor pollutants that affect indoor air quality.
Seasonal pollen from grasses, trees, and wildflowers peaks in spring and fall. Enhanced filtration during these periods reduces allergen infiltration.
Dust from construction projects and unpaved areas enters homes through open windows and HVAC intakes. Upgrading filters and sealing duct connections minimizes dust accumulation.
Outdoor air pollution from nearby highways and industrial zones can penetrate indoor spaces. Ventilation systems with filtration ensure fresh air intake remains clean.
